小编Hun*_*rby的帖子

如何在 WebView 中添加 Pull to Refresh?

我对开发很陌生。我正在构建一个 WebView,我希望它具有拉动刷新功能。我该如何快速做到这一点?

我在视图控制器中的代码是

@IBOutlet var webView: UIWebView!

override func viewDidLoad() {
    super.viewDidLoad()

    func webViewDidFinishLoad(webView: UIWebView) {
        UIApplication.sharedApplication().networkActivityIndicatorVisible = false
    }

    func webViewDidStartLoad(webView: UIWebView) {
        UIApplication.sharedApplication().networkActivityIndicatorVisible = true
    }

    let url = NSURL (string: "https://www.foo.com");
    let requestObj = NSURLRequest(URL: url!);
    webView.loadRequest(requestObj);
    NSUserDefaults.standardUserDefaults().registerDefaults(["UserAgent": "Mozilla/5.0 (Macintosh; Intel Mac OS X 10_11_4) AppleWebKit/601.5.17 (KHTML, like Gecko) Version/9.1 Safari/601.5.17"])
}


override func didReceiveMemoryWarning() {
    super.didReceiveMemoryWarning()

}
Run Code Online (Sandbox Code Playgroud)

uiwebview webview ios pull-to-refresh swift

2
推荐指数
1
解决办法
7701
查看次数

标签 统计

ios ×1

pull-to-refresh ×1

swift ×1

uiwebview ×1

webview ×1